Or you can actually use the ClassInitGenerator.exe in your output
directory directly:
classinitgenerator IronRuby.Libraries.dll Ruby.Libraries
LibrariesInitalizer > Initializer.Generated.cs
copy Initializer.Generated.cs to trunk/src/IronRuby.Libraries/
recompile.

> > I've checked out revision 76 of IronRuby, and finally got it setup in
> > VS2008 where everything was compiling. For some reason the VS project
> > file looks for the sub-projects in the wrong locations, and you have
> > to redirect it to the proper project locations, and reset all the
> > references.
>
> You should use the *other* solution in that directory - IronRuby.sln. That
> points to the right locations.
>
>
> > I thought I would try to hack in a few more of the ruby string
> > methods, and located the source file in the "MutableStringOps.cs" file
> > in the IronRuby.Libraries project. I've written the code, but for
> > some reason, it won't get called. I've cleaned the solution, and
> > built from scratch. I have a feeling I'm missing something obvious.
> > I've continued to simplify it until now I have this:
> >
> > [RubyMethodAttribute("reverse",
> > RubyMethodAttributes.PublicInstance)]
> > public static MutableString/*!*/ Reverse(MutableString/*!*/
> > self) {
> > MutableString result = new MutableString("reverse"); //just
> > temp
> > return result;
> > }
> >
>
> You'll need to run 'rake gen' from the command line to regenerate the
> Initializers.Generated.cs file.
